Square Yard (yd²)
Definition: A square yard (yd²) is an imperial unit of area equal to a square with sides of one yard.
History: Derived from the yard, which originated in medieval England for measuring textiles and land.
Current Use: Still used in real estate, carpeting, and some engineering applications.
Square Foot (ft²)
Definition: A square foot (ft²) is an imperial unit of area equal to a square with sides of one foot.
History: Historically used in construction and property measurement, especially in English-speaking countries.
Current Use: Commonly used in real estate, architecture, and interior design, especially in the US and UK.
